Kanye West, known as Ye, has once again topped the charts with his latest single “Carnival” from the album “Vultures 1,” featuring Ty Dolla $ign.

This achievement marks his fifth number-one hit, highlighting his enduring success in the music industry spanning two decades. Ye took to Instagram to celebrate but veered into controversy with a fiery post.

In his celebratory message, Ye thanked collaborators Rich the Kid, Ty Dolla $ign, and Playboi Carti, but things quickly escalated.

The Chicago rapper launched into a tirade, targeting adversaries such as Adidas, Drake, and surprisingly, “every Christian.”

Accusations flew as Ye accused Adidas of trying to undermine him and criticized those associated with the brand. He also took aim at unnamed fashion houses and Drake for perceived slights.

Of particular note was Ye’s cryptic reference to “every Christian that watched me have my kids taken out of my control,” hinting at personal struggles and a potential rift with his faith.

The post concluded with a promise of more grievances, leaving fans and critics alike anticipating who might be next on Ye’s target list.

Despite the controversies, Kanye West remains one of the best-selling music artists globally, with numerous accolades including 24 Grammy Awards, making him one of the most decorated hip-hop artists in history.
